Copy Files action
 
Is it possible to make the copy files action fail if one of the files
listed to be copied isn't found? or do i have to use the vbscript filecopy function and check its return value?

kinook 03-06-2003 08:49 PM

No. One option would be, before copying, to add a step that conditionally builds (and fails) if the file doesn't exist. For instance, a Run Program step with a command of 'File xyz does not exist', and a conditional build rule of '[vbld_FSO.FileExists("xyz")]' equal to 0. Or you could use a Run Program step of %DOSCMD% copy xyz on the individual file, and it will fail if the file doesn't exist.

I think an option like "Fail build when one or more files are not found." to this step would really help.

I guess this is not quite possible because this step supports wildcard. So it is not able to do a proper counting.

kinook 04-30-2012 06:28 AM

If you're doing a non-incremental, non-recursive copy, aren't excluding any files, and the files listed to be copied are all filenames and not wildcards or folders, you could use script code like this in the step's vbld_StepDone script event to fail if the copy count doesn't match the filename count:

Code:

Sub vbld_StepDone()
  ' fail the step if the number of files to be included does not match the number of files copied
  If UBound(Split(Step.Property("Ext"), vbCrLf))+1 <> vbld_TempMacros()("COPYFILES_COPY_COUNT") Then
    Builder.LogMessage2 "Number of copied files does not match list of files to copy", vbldLogLevelError
    Step.BuildStatus = vbldStepStatFailed
  End If
End Sub
